Mumbai, Nov. 27 -- The key equity indices ended with modest gains, extending their advance for a second straight session. The Sensex and Nifty touched fresh record highs during the day before easing off toward the close. A large part of the mid-cap and small-cap universe remained in a corrective or fragile zone. Investors are focused on tomorrow's domestic GDP data and key events such as the US-India trade discussions and the upcoming RBI policy meeting, all of which could influence near-term market direction. The Nifty closed above 26,200, supported by strength in banking and financial stocks.

The S&P BSE Sensex jumped 110.87 points or 0.13% to 85,720.38. The Nifty 50 index rose 10.25 points or 0.04% to 26,215.55.
